The most beautiful bookshop in the world


El Ateneo Grand Splendid, in Buenos Aires, Argentina, is regarded as one of the world's most beautiful bookshops. The building first opened as a theatre, Teatro Gran Splendid, in 1919 with a seating capacity of 1,050. It was converted to a cinema in 1929, and then into a book (and music) store in 2000.

The building has been renovated since being built, but much of the original charm remains, including the ceiling, stage curtains, auditorium lighting, ornate carvings and many architectural details.



The address is 1860 Santa Fe Avenue, Buenos Aires (Spanish: Avenida Santa Fe 1860, BsAs, Capital Federal). Don't forget to appreciate the building from the outside. And look up, as I clearly didn't in the above photo.

Book shelves have replaced the old cinema seating.
The stage now functions as a cafe.
Sit in one of the theatre boxes and read through a book or two... so there's no need to buy anything.
The original balconies of the old theatre.

It's a multistory building, so it's great for spying on people. The top floor is devoted to exhibitions, and the basement is for children's books and music.
